## Webhook Retries in Dripletter

Quick heads-up for whoever inherits this: Dripletter retries failed webhook deliveries with exponential backoff, capped at six attempts over roughly 36 hours. Duplicate deliveries can happen, so receivers must be idempotent — we key on the event token. Dead-lettered events land in the Marrow queue and need manual replay. The replay console lives behind a locked admin panel, and yes, the lock is deliberate. To open the replay console, enter the recovery passphrase below.

strongbox words: praath-pelys-ulaion

## Deploying the Gatewick Proctor Queue

Deploys are pretty painless: push to main, wait for the pipeline, then watch the queue drain dashboard for five minutes. If candidates pile up mid-exam, roll back first and ask questions later — the queue replays safely. Everything the workers care about lives in one config block, shown here for reference.

settings of bafof-yagef:
JOROX_PIN=8740
JOROX_TENANT=pelox
JOROX_METRICS_HOST=metrics.jorox.qorvelworks.internal
JOROX_SEAL=seal_c78f63c1
JOROX_STANDBY_TEAM=norax

Finance Review Summary — Expansion into the Carwick Basin

Prepared for heads of department. Capital outlay for the proposed Carwick Basin entry is estimated conservatively, with a contingency of fifteen percent applied to fit-out and logistics. Payback modelling assumes modest first-year volumes. Currency exposure is limited but has been hedged in the base case. The associated strategic considerations are noted immediately below.

board note of kageg-bahof: The renewal with Holwynax Holdings closes at $2 million a year, 5 percent below the last contract. Project Ulaath slips by two quarters because of the supplier delay.

TURN-208: Gatevale turnstile counters at the Merrow Field pilot double-count when a rotation reverses mid-cycle. Attendance totals drift roughly 2% high per event. The debounce window fix is implemented, reviewed by Ilsa, and soak-tested across two simulated match days without drift. Ready for your cut; the candidate build is identified below.

trace token, tagag-tafog: htk6_5ed18c